We have developed a "FIX" compliant server and would like to verify that we have correctly interpreted the FIX spec. Are there any test tools available that we can use? Is there some sort of certification process that we can go through?

There is not currently a certification process, however, we are actively working to establish one. Please see the “Working Groups”, “Certification” section for more details. We would also like to encourage everyone involved in FIX to complete the online survey located there to help us better understand the community’s requirements.
